Managing logistics for e-waste is notoriously tricky. Unlike cardboard or plastic, electronic devices vary wildly in density. A pallet of high-end rack servers is going to weigh significantly more than a pallet of empty computer cases. If you don't calculate these weights accurately, you might find yourself sending trucks out half-empty or, worse, overloaded. Formula Explanation
If you are curious about what’s happening under the hood, it really comes down to standard density calculation: Mass equals Density multiplied by Volume. While that sounds like a basic physics lesson from high school, the complexity arises when you factor in the air gaps found in jumbled e-waste. Our tool uses weighted averages for typical e-waste profiles, ensuring the volume you input—which includes those unavoidable gaps—is translated into a weight that mimics real-world packing scenarios.
Don’t worry, it’s not just a black box. The converter accounts for 'stowage factor,' which is a common pitfall people often overlook. If you assume a perfect solid mass, you’ll always overestimate weight. By incorporating these volume-to-weight metrics, our tool provides a safety buffer that keeps your transportation planning within legal and safe limits.

Common Mistakes
One of the most common issues we see is people failing to account for the pallet itself. Remember, that wooden structure has weight too! Another pitfall is forgetting to check the units. We have seen teams accidentally input centimeters when they meant inches, which leads to wildly inaccurate totals. Always take a second to verify your units before signing off on a freight bill. Finally, don't assume that 'full' means a consistent density. If you have a crate of heavy CRT monitors at the bottom and light plastic keyboards at the top, adjust your density settings to reflect that average for the best results.
